Objective: Hemolysis, elevated liver enzymes and low platelets (HELLP) syndrome is a complication of preeclampsia.We aimed to estimate the association between first-trimester placental growth factor (PlGF) and other preeclampsia risk factors with HELLP syndrome. Methods:We performed a secondary analysis of a prospective cohort of nulliparous women recruited at 11-14 weeks of gestation and stratified according to pregnancy outcome: HELLP syndrome, preeclampsia without HELLP syndrome, or neither (controls).We compared the three groups for first-trimester maternal age, body mass index (BMI), mean arterial pressure (MAP), uterine artery pulsatility index (UtA-PI) and serum PlGF in multiples of the median (MoM), using non-parametric and ROC curve analyses.Results: Of the 7325 eligible participants, 27 (0.4%) developed HELLP syndrome and 228 (3.1%) developed preeclampsia without HELLP.Median PlGF was lower in the preeclampsia (median: 0.85 MoM; IQR: 0.61-1.15;P < 0.001), and HELLP syndrome (0.72 MoM; IQR: 0.55-1.09,P < 0.001) groups, compared to controls (1.02 MoM; IQR: 0.72-1.43).At PlGF0.7 MoM the prediction rate for preterm and term HELLP was 56% and 33%, respectively, and the respective values for preeclampsia without HELLP were 50% and 30%, respectively, at a false positive rate of 17%.In HELLP syndrome, unlike preeclampsia without HELLP, there was no association with first-trimester BMI, MAP or UtA-PI.
